SSH Collection Module

The SSH Collection Module provides data collection for Linux and UNIX-class systems as part of the RISC Networks engagement process. It uses the Secure Shell (SSH) protocol to communicate with in-scope discovered devices to collect identifying inventory data as well as ongoing performance data.

SSH is an industry-standard protocol that provides an encrypted, authenticated channel of communication between devices, forming the backbone of most systems’ orchestration frameworks today. The SSH Collection Module acts as an SSH client to communicate with SSH servers running on devices in the environment. The SSH Collection Module utilizes OpenSSH, the current de-facto standard SSH distribution.

Previously, collection from Linux and UNIX-class systems was conducted using the SNMP protocol. While SNMP is still supported for these device types, the SSH Collection Module can replace the SNMP protocol for all data collection. The SSH Collection Module does not support collection from network devices, which still require the use of SNMP.

Note:Please note that the SSH Collection Module is a separate feature from the CLI data collection process for Cisco network devices using the telnet/SSH protocols.

For more information on system eligibility for participation in the SSH Collection Module, see the following topics:

SSH Collection Module Overview
Supported Operating Systems
System Eligibility
Credential Utilization
User Account Requirements
Authentication Types
Key-Based Authentication Requirements
Privilege Elevation
Entering Credentials
Custom Server Ports
Configuration Examples
SSH Collection Module Troubleshooting